Output d70df26bbd986c2b54d425fddcbe07bda0b888a3d814bbd1c80349ba70c5cb23:0

value
39227094
script pubkey
OP_0 OP_PUSHBYTES_20 cc5c4cc7c3b26a18908724d1f626eae0c65f64bc
address
bc1qe3wye37rkf4p3yy8ynglvfh2urr97e9ulj5qmw
transaction
d70df26bbd986c2b54d425fddcbe07bda0b888a3d814bbd1c80349ba70c5cb23
spent
true